Mortadella di Prato

Also known as: Mortadella pratese

Mortadella di Prato is a cooked pork charcuterie product from Prato, Tuscany, distinguished by the mandatory inclusion of Alkermes liqueur, which imparts a characteristic deep-pink interior colour. The specification prescribes precise proportions of six pork cuts, defined spice ingredients, sea salt, and garlic, and prohibits the addition of sodium glutamate.

About this designation

Mortadella di Prato is registered as a PGI under file number PGI-IT-01333, with EU protection granted on 8 May 2015 (eAmbrosia identifier EUGI00000015954). The product is a cooked pork charcuterie composed exclusively of six defined cuts — shoulder, lard, ham trimmings, neck, cheeks, and breast — in proportions fixed by the specification. Alkermes liqueur is a mandatory ingredient at between 0.3 and 0.6 % of the mixture; ground pepper, whole peppercorns, sea salt, powdered spices (coriander, cinnamon, nutmeg, mace, and cloves), and garlic are also required within defined percentage ranges. The addition of sodium glutamate is expressly prohibited. Pigs used must weigh at least 160 kg (within a margin of ± 10 %) and must be more than 9 months old at slaughter. A minimum interval of 24 hours and a maximum of 96 hours must elapse between slaughter and processing. All production stages — trimming, mincing and mixing, stuffing and tying, steaming and cooking, rinsing and cooling — must take place continuously within the delimited geographical area of Prato. The finished product is cylindrical or broadly elliptical, weighing between 0.5 and 10 kg, with a length of between 8 and 70 cm and a diameter of between 6 and 35 cm. The fat-to-protein ratio must not exceed 1.5.

Tasting notes

Tuscan pink mortadella distinct from Bologna by Alkermes liqueur infusion, giving rosy hue and sweet-spicy aromatic notes; firmer texture, less fat than Bologna, with garlic, mace, and clove.

HoReCa use

Documentary sources from the eighteenth century record the practice of serving Mortadella di Prato with figs; the specification also notes its traditional use in sedani alla pratese, a local pasta dish.
